Configuration vs. information: An informational explanation of command relations

In this paper, we show that configurational notions follow from inherent properties of informational concepts. First, we analyze the hidden complexity of the central family of configuralional relations (command) from which all the others (government, proper government, etc.) are derived. We then examine the different types of grammatical information, their sources and their propagation mode. Finally we show how simple and general constraints on these might make syntactic dependencies appear to be governed by configurational relations such as command, but just like the Stars might appear to be turning around the Earth.

Bovine trypanosomiasis is a significant health concern for livestock intensification in Côte d’Ivoire. This study aimed to determine the prevalence and distribution of pathogenic trypanosomes and identify the most infected cattle breed in northern Côte d'Ivoire. We examined 700 cattle and found that polymerase chain reaction (PCR) was more sensitive (12.3%) than microscopic observation (5.6%). Among the trypanosome species detected in naturally infected cattle, Trypanosoma vivax was 7.3%, Trypanosoma simiae tsavo was 6.7%, and Trypanosoma congolense was 0.4%. The overall prevalence of trypanosome infection in all cattle breeds was 12.3%, while the prevalence in individual breeds was 14.8%, 7.3%, 10.6%, and 12.3% for N’Dama, Baoule, Zebu, and Mere breed, respectively. The infected animals had low packed cell volume, influencing the prevalence. Our findings indicate that bovine trypanosomes are prevalent in Côte d’Ivoire, and their prevalence varies by region and breed. These pathogens include T. vivax, T. simiae tsavo, and T. congolense.
ICPECVD-Dielectric Thin-Films CMOS-Compatible: Trends in Eco-Friendly Deposition

Depositions of the dielectric thin-films at low temperatures without greenhouse gas, nitrous oxide (N 2 O) is one of the most critical challenges in modern technologies for microelectronics, optoelectronics, and nanoelectronics. The present study demonstrates that thin dielectric layers deposit by inductively-coupled plasma-enhanced chemical vapor deposition (ICPECVD) technology at lower temperatures ( < 300 ◦ C) can be successfully optimized and has the potential to reduce the environmental impact signifcantly. A particular focus is made on the improvement of the optical properties that are strongly correlated to the physicochemical bonds fi lm properties. Typical deposition rates range from 10 to 20 nm/min, depending mainly on power, pressure, and gas flows. This study opens up large scale applications that require lower hydrogen content and a stable process. The presented results emphasize green manufacturing technologies and can be valuable for a wide range of applications using a complementary metal-oxide-semiconductor (CMOS)-compatible technology.

Several clinical practice guidelines related to the assessment and management of low back pain (LBP) have been published with varied scopes and methods. This paper summarises the first French occupational guidelines for management of work-related LBP (October 2013). There main originality is to treat all the three stages of primary, secondary and tertiary prevention of work-related LBP. The guidelines were written by a multidisciplinary working group of 24 experts, according to the Clinical Practice Guidelines method proposed by French National Health Authority, and reviewed by a multidisciplinary peer review committee of 50 experts. Recommendations were based on a large systematic review of the literature carried out from 1990 to 2012 and rated as strong (Level A), moderate (B), limited (C) or based on expert consensus (D) according to their level of evidence. It is recommended to deliver reassuring and consistent information concerning LBP prognosis (Level B); to perform a clinical examination looking for medical signs of severity related to LBP (Level A), encourage continuation or resumption of physical activity (Level A), identify any changes in working conditions and evaluate the occupational impact of LBP (Level D). In case of persistent/recurrent LBP, assess prognostic factors likely to influence progression to chronic LBP, prolonged disability and delayed return to work (Level A). In case of prolonged/repeated sick leave, evaluate the pain, functional disability and their impact and main risk factors for prolonged work disability (Level A), promote return to work measures and inter professional coordination (Level D). These good practice guidelines are primarily intended for professionals of occupational health but also for treating physicians and paramedical personnel participating in the management of LBP, workers and employers.

Objective To determine whether post-stroke patient’s perceived exertion correlates with effort intensity score as measured by a wearable sensor and to assess whether estimates of perceived exertion are correlated to the cerebral hemisphere involved in the stroke. Methods We evaluated the effort intensity score during physiotherapy sessions using a wearable sensor and subjects assessed their perceived exertion using the modified Borg CR10 Scale. Results Fifty-seven subacute stroke patients participated in the study. The correlation between perceived exertion rating and measured effort intensity was insignificant—mean (r=-0.04, p=0.78) and peak (r=-0.05, p=0.70). However, there was a significant difference (p<0.02) in the perceived exertion ratings depending on the cerebral hemisphere where the stroke occurred. Patients with left-hand side lesions rated their perceived exertion as 4.5 (min–max, 0.5–8), whereas patients with right-hand side lesions rated their perceived exertion as 5.0 (2–8). Conclusion While there was an insignificant correlation between perceived exertion and effort intensity measured by a wearable sensor, a consistent variations in perceived exertion estimates according to the side of the cerebral lesion was identified and established.
ESR1 Mutation Detection and Dynamics in Meningeal Carcinomatosis in Breast Cancer

ESR1 mutation is frequently encountered in hormone receptor (HR)-positive, human epidermal growth factor receptor 2 (HER2)-negative metastatic breast cancer (MBC), especially after aromatase inhibitor (AI) therapy, as a mechanism of resistance to endocrine therapy. Circulating tumor DNA-based detection of ESR1 mutation in plasma has been demonstrated as a prognostic and predictive factor for poor outcomes in subsequent AI therapy. In this case report, for the first time, we describe the detection of ESR1 mutation (p.Tyr537Ser) only in the cerebrospinal fluid (CSF) and not in the plasma of a patient with isolated leptomeningeal progression who was treated with AI for HR-positive, HER2-negative MBC (bone metastasis only). Circulating tumor DNA levels also appeared to be correlated with clinical evolution. We suggest that in the presence of isolated leptomeningeal metastasis and when tamoxifen or AI has been prescribed for HR-positive MBC, CSF should be screened for ESR1 mutations to potentially adjust systemic treatment.
